What Bone-Conduction Headphones Are—and Why Shokz Leads
Bone-conduction headphones are open-ear headphones that rest on your cheekbones and send sound through vibrations in the bones of your skull, leaving your ear canals fully open so you can hear music and ambient noise at the same time. Shokz has become the name most people associate with this technology, building a full range of bone-conduction and open-ear headphones that target runners, outdoor athletes, and daily listeners. How Shokz Bone-Conduction Tech Keeps You Aware and Safe
Traditional in-ear buds and over-ear headphones can seal off your ears, which is not ideal when you need situational awareness. Shokz bone-conduction headphones sit in front of your ears instead, so you can track traffic, announcements, and people around you while still hearing music, podcasts, or coaching cues. Runner’s World notes that this open-ear design is a major reason Shokz models are so popular with runners and other outdoor athletes, who value being able to hear cars, cyclists, and other runners. The OpenRun and OpenRun Pro lines combine this awareness with sweat resistance and a secure wraparound frame that stays in place during harder efforts. For commuters and anyone who walks or rides in busy areas, that same design makes Shokz an appealing alternative to noise-isolating earbuds that can make the world around you feel blocked off.
